The purpose of this email is to notify you that the California Department of Education (CDE) has sent an apportionment to the State Controller’s Office for payment. This apportionment, in the amount of $262,383,458, is made from the state General Fund in support of the Expanded Learning Opportunities Grant (ELO-G), established pursuant to Section 2 of Assembly Bill (AB) 86 (Chapter 10, Statutes of 2021) and amended pursuant to Section 34 of AB 130 (Chapter 44, Statutes of 2021) and Section 12 of AB 167 (Chapter 252, Statutes of 2021). The ELO-G funds are provided for purposes such as extending instructional learning time, accelerating progress to close learning gaps ad integrated pupil supports to address other barriers to learning.
The state General Fund amounts paid in this apportionment reflect the remaining state funds due to local educational agencies and state special schools. In order to be eligible for remaining federal ELO-G apportionments, LEAs must submit assurances and will also be required to submit quarterly expenditure reports to the CDE as federal ELO-G funds are subject to federal cash management rules and regulations.
